Points Conversion: The Numbers You Need to Know
Let me be blunt. The points conversion is where most sites steal your money. I hate it. They give you 500 points and tell you it is worth £5. But then they require 5000 points to cash out. That is a lie. I made a small table to show you what I look for.
| Feature | Good Site | Bad Site |
|---|---|---|
| Points per £1 wagered | 1 point | 0.5 points |
| Conversion rate | 100 points = £1 | 500 points = £1 |
| Minimum cashout | £5 (500 points) | £25 (12,500 points) |
| Point expiry | 12 months | 90 days |
| Bonus on conversion | 10% extra points monthly | None |
If a site has a bad table like the one on the right, walk away. There are dozens of variations of these tables. Do not get stuck in a bad one. How to Pick a Site for 2026 (A Simple Guide)
Stop reading the flashy adverts. They lie. I use a simple checklist. It has not changed in 20 years. If a site passes these checks, I give them my money.
- UKGC License: Check the footer. It must say ‘Licensed by the UK Gambling Commission’. If it does not, do not play. It is illegal for them to target UK players without it.
- Simple Games: Do they have 3-reel slots? Do they have 75-ball or 90-ball bingo? If they only have Megaways and video slots, I leave.
- Points System: How fast do I earn points? Can I cash them out easily? Is there a minimum? I want a low minimum.
- Customer Support: I called them. If they answer in 2 minutes, that is good. If they put me on hold for 10 minutes, I hang up.
- Withdrawal Speed: I want my money in 24 hours. Not 5 days. E-wallets are faster than bank transfers.
